Patent classifications
G06Q30/0275
Advertising Delivery Control System
A dynamically regulated advertising delivery control system. A campaign is operated by sending bids to an exchange responsive to receiving bid requests from the exchange, each bid request representing an opportunity to expose a browser to content. Won bid notifications are received from the exchange and exposure notifications are received from exposed browsers. Failed exposures are detected by detecting won bid notification identifiers without corresponding exposure notification identifiers. Responsive to the failed exposures exceeding an upper limit, the campaign is operated in a throttled mode by sending bids to the exchange in response to a fraction of the suitable bid requests received from the exchange and ignoring some suitable bid requests. Responsive to detecting successful exposures in the throttled mode, the operation of the campaign is dynamically regulated by increasing the fraction.
Method and system for providing rewardable consumer engagement opportunities
A an exchange of rewardable consumer engagement opportunities includes generating a rewardable consumer engagement opportunity (RCEO) having one or more characteristics based on received entity information in response to an entity request, generating a bank of one or more rewards based on the one or more characteristics of the rewardable consumer engagement opportunity, receiving a user-initiated request for a reward based on a reported performance of a user from a communications device, determining a location of the user performance, identifying a reward in the bank of one or more rewards compatible with the reported user performance and a determined location of the user performance, transmitting the identified reward to the communications device, receiving a response from the communications device confirming acceptance or rejection of the reward and adjusting the reward bank to reflect acceptance or rejection of the reward.
System, method, and computer program for serving online content to users based on real world user information
A method and system for analyzing real world information of users to derive physical (real world) user attributes used for selecting online content for presentation by client devices correlated with the users, comprising, detecting a presence of one or more users in a physical registration location by analyzing sensory data captured by one or more sensors deployed to monitor the physical registration location, correlating between the user(s) and an identifier of client device(s) associated with the user(s), identifying one or more user attributes of the user(s) by analyzing the sensory data and transmitting the user attribute(s) coupled with the identifier to one or more remote servers adapted to use the user attribute(s) for selecting one or more online content items served to the client device(s) via a network for presentation to the user(s). The sensor(s) is physically and communicatively disconnected from the client device(s).
Automated process for ranking segmented video files
System for ranking segmented video files, comprising a server including a computer, said server including one or more segmented video files stored in a video database, each said segmented video file containing video information for visually reproducing at least one video object, where a video object is a visual component of the video file; an object inventory database operating on said server and containing information describing a location of said at least one video object within each of at least one image frame within at least one of the segmented video files; the server executing software indexing each segmented video file for the occurrence of at least one video object; the server executing software determining a duration of time that the at least one video object appears in each video file.
Auto-expanding campaign optimization
A computerized method of dynamically expanding an online advertisement campaign, comprising receiving from an advertiser an advertisement policy for an online advertisement campaign for offered item(s), the advertisement policy includes policy setting(s) and expanding the online advertisement campaign through multiple iterations. Each iteration comprises bidding to purchase candidate online advertisement space(s) of a plurality of available online advertisement spaces for small-scale use where the candidate online advertisement space(s) are selected by analyzing a performance of each of the available online advertisement spaces with respect to the online advertisement campaign according to the policy setting(s), placing an advertisement at the purchased online advertisement space(s) and determining a performance of the purchased online advertisement space(s) by calculating a performance score, adding the purchased online advertisement space(s) to a group of large-scale online advertisement spaces in case the performance score satisfies predefined criterion(s) and bidding for purchase of the group for large-scale use.
Digital advertising bidding method, digital advertising bidding system, token generating server, data management server and campaign management method
A digital advertising bidding method and a digital advertising bidding system are provided. The digital advertising bidding method includes receiving an ad request with an identifier by a token generating server; encrypting the identifier to generate a token corresponding to the ad request to replace the identifier by the token generating server; transmitting the token and a corresponding bid request to a demand side server by the token generating server; transmitting the token and the identifier to a data management server by the token generating server; requesting a targeting information corresponding to the token from the data management server by the demand side server; and transmitting the targeting information to the demand side server by the data management server.
Systems and methods for processing data involving digital content, digital products and/or experiences, such as throughout auction, sweepstakes and/or fulfillment processing
The systems and methods described herein relate to processing of information, data and automated transaction information involving content and/or experiences. In some exemplary implementations, illustrative automated methods of computerized information processing may involve automated auction processing, sweepstakes processing, handling, fulfillment and/or particular checkout processing of product(s) and/or item(s), including product(s) and/or item(s) such as experiences, physical products, digital products, and/or other offerings by luminaries. According to certain implementations, various product types, flag and/or identifiers are utilized in automated transformations of various purchasable products among the various offerings.
Systems, methods, and devices for digital advertising ecosystems implementing content delivery networks utilizing edge computing
Disclosed herein are systems and techniques for using a content delivery network to perform various functions within a digital advertising ecosystem, in ways that yield technological benefits such as improved security, efficiency, and speed (for example, reduction in publisher load times). As one specific example, a content delivery network can be used for the creation of electronic tokens for user identity protection between demand side platforms, supply side platforms, content creators (for example, advertisers), and publishers.
SYSTEMS AND METHODS FOR USING SERVER SIDE COOKIES BY A DEMAND SIDE PLATFORM
The present disclosure is directed to methods for identifying a user by a demand side platform (DSP) across advertiser exchanges. The method includes establishing, by a DSP, a cookie mapping for a user. The cookie mapping includes a mapping of user identifiers for the user from advertisement exchanges to a user identifier assigned by the DSP for the user. The DSP stores to the cookie mapping a first mapping to the user identifier of the DSP, comprising a first user id received by a bidder from a first exchange and a first exchange id for the first exchange. A bidder inserts a pixel into a bid for an impression opportunity to a second exchange. The pixel includes a key to the cookie mapping and a second user id for the user and a second exchange id. The second user id is received by the bidder from a second exchange.
SYSTEMS AND METHODS FOR CUSTOMER VALUATION AND MERCHANT BIDDING
A mediator system, which serves as a conduit between a customer and merchants, includes customer profile data. The mediator system analyzes the customer profile data, and assigns an indication to a customer represented by the customer profile data. The mediator system then provides the indication to the merchants, and then receives bids from the merchants. The bids are for establishing a connection between the merchants and the customer. The mediator system provides to a portion of the merchants, based on the bids, a connection to the customer.